Thai specialists prefer laparoscopic excision for endometriosis because it removes the entire lesion. This technique is the gold standard for deep infiltrating disease. Experts at facilities like Intrarat Hospital use excision to collect tissue samples for biopsy. This method effectively prevents the disease from returning quickly.

Thai surgeons use single-port laparoscopy for simpler cases like ovarian cysts. However, traditional multi-port laparoscopy remains the standard for complex endometriosis. Leading specialists in Thailand hold certifications in laparoscopic gynecological surgery. They prioritize complete lesion removal over niche port techniques for better results.

Surgeons in Thailand use robotic technology like the da Vinci system to treat deep infiltrating endometriosis. This method provides the 3D magnification and precision required for complex pelvic dissections. Specialists at ISO-accredited facilities often combine robotics with minimally invasive techniques to protect sensitive pelvic organs.

La sanità è il settore di sviluppo chiave del governo thailandese. Le autorità thailandesi sono convinte che l'assistenza alla salute dei cittadini debba essere una priorità assoluta della politica statale e spendono circa 25 miliardi di baht per l'assistenza sanitaria ogni anno.
Di conseguenza, 36.673 strutture mediche forniscono eccellenti cure mediche nel paese. 64 centri nel Regno hanno la certificazione della JCI (Joint Commission International), l'organizzazione internazionale che migliora la qualità e la sicurezza nell'assistenza sanitaria a livello globale. L'indice di certificati ottenuti è il più grande. Per confronto, Israele ha 20 strutture accreditate dalla JCI, e la Germania — solo 10 cliniche di questo tipo.

Il principale vantaggio dei resort thailandesi è la lunga stagione balneare. Sulla costa est e sulla costa ovest le caratteristiche climatiche sono diverse, quindi è importante tenerne conto quando si pianifica il viaggio. Il periodo migliore per viaggiare è durante la stagione fresca e secca tra novembre e inizio aprile. Un grande afflusso di turisti avviene tra marzo e maggio, quando la temperatura dell'aria è di +30°C.
